Transport and distribution of bacteria and diatoms in the aqueous surface microlayer of a salt marsh
Authors:Ronald W Harvey  Leonard W Lion  Lily Y Young
Institution:Department of Civil Engineering, Stanford University, Stanford, CA 94035 USA
Abstract:The effects of tide and wind upon the distribution and transport of bacteria and diatoms in the aqueous surface microlayers of a Massachusetts and San Francisco Bay salt marsh were examined. The compression of the surface films by both tide and wind resulted in significant enrichments of bacterioneuston. At the San Francisco Bay site, significant numbers of diatoms were transported within the microlayer over a tidal cycle.
Keywords:surface layers  neuston  salt marshes  San Francisco Bay  Massachusetts coast
